NISHINOMIYA, Japan - Masahiro Tanaka earned his 202nd career win spanning Japanese professional baseball and the U.S. major leagues, surpassing a mark set by Japanese Hall of Famer Hideo Nomo, as the Yomiuri Giants edged the Hanshin Tigers 4-3 on Thursday.

A former ace of the New York Yankees, Tanaka (2-0) allowed three runs on seven hits with four strikeouts over six innings at Koshien Stadium.
